Position Overview
At Unified Door & Hardware Group (UDHG),
Assistant Project Managers
support the Project Team by helping plan, coordinate, and track all aspects of assigned projects. With strong organization and communication skills, you play a key role in ensuring smooth project execution and supporting UDHG's commitment to excellence in the building products industry.

Technical Review & Submittals
Identify door swings, frame elevations, jamb profiles, wall types, and hardware information from architectural drawings
Read, analyze, and understand hardware, wood door, and hollow metal specifications to effectively create, update, or coordinate related submittals including literature for architect review
Engineering Support & Scope Compliance
Ensures that Engineering functions are completed in accordance with established production and contract scope requirements
Works closely with Engineering to maintain project schedules, implement changes/revisions, review and revise returned submittals as required
